Turn one’s stomach
Directions: In the following items, an idiom or a proverb is given. Select the response that correctly describes the meaning of the idiom or proverb and mark your response on the Answer Sheet accordingly.
- A. Being nauseated by something or someone. ✓
- B. Being plagued by a stomach upset.
- C. Unable to cope with the changes.
- D. Switch sides while asleep.
Correct Answer: A. Being nauseated by something or someone.
Explanation
To turn one's stomach means to make someone feel ill, nauseated, or deeply disgusted.
